Preparing Your Sarasota Home for Winter
As a snowbird, ensuring your Sarasota home is well-prepared before heading north for the winter is crucial. Proper home maintenance not only protects your property but also provides peace of mind while you're away. Here are some essential DIY maintenance tips to get your home ready for the season.

Inspect and Secure Windows and Doors
Start by checking all windows and doors for drafts and potential leaks. Seal any gaps with weatherstripping or caulk to prevent moisture and pests from entering. Additionally, ensure all locks are functioning properly to secure your home against break-ins.
Consider installing storm shutters or impact-resistant windows if you haven't already. These will protect your property from any unexpected storms that might occur while you're away.
Maintain Your HVAC System
Your heating, ventilation, and air conditioning (HVAC) system requires attention before you leave. Change the air filters and set the thermostat to a temperature that will prevent pipes from freezing while conserving energy. Ideally, this should be around 55°F (13°C).
Schedule a professional HVAC inspection to ensure the system is in optimal condition. This can prevent costly repairs and improve energy efficiency.

Plumbing Preparations
To avoid plumbing disasters in your absence, turn off the water supply to your home. Drain all pipes by opening faucets and flushing toilets until they run dry. Consider adding antifreeze to toilet bowls and drains to prevent any remaining water from freezing.
If you have a pool, lower the water level and cover it securely to protect against debris and algae growth.
Electrical System Checks
Unplug non-essential appliances and electronics to save energy and reduce the risk of electrical fires. Install timers on lights to give the appearance of occupancy, deterring potential intruders.

Ensure that your security system is active and functioning properly. Consider adding smart technology that allows you to monitor security cameras remotely.
Outdoor Maintenance
Trim trees and shrubs away from the house to minimize damage during storms. Secure outdoor furniture, grills, and other items that might become hazardous in high winds.
Clean gutters and downspouts to prevent water backup and ensure proper drainage. This step is crucial in avoiding potential water damage during heavy rainfalls.
